Differences in Prokaryotic Community Composition Between Two Climatically Contrasting Years in an Arctic Fjord Ecosystem

open access: yesEnvironmental Microbiology Reports, Volume 18, Issue 2, April 2026.
Seasonal dynamics of prokaryotic communities in Kongsfjorden were driven by contrasting hydrographic conditions in 2019 and 2020. Atlantification enhanced prokaryotic diversity and interactions in 2019, while sea ice and glacial runoff in 2020 reduced surface diversity and network complexity, underscoring Arctic prokaryotic sensitivity to environmental

Neural and Behavioral Tracking of Musical Phrases Occurs Without Temporal Regularity

open access: yesEuropean Journal of Neuroscience, Volume 63, Issue 7, April 2026.
When listening to music or speech, people naturally segment continuous sound streams into meaningful units. We investigated how the temporal predictability of segment boundaries influences listeners' ability to track musical structure. Both neural and behavioral measures showed robust tracking of musical phrasing regardless of boundary regularity ...

Riemann's method of integration. Its extensions with an application

open access: yesCollectanea Mathematica, 1953
The classical method of integration of hypcrbolic differential equations, due to Riemann, is developed and extended. The cases in which the Cauchy data is discontinuous and the initial curve is cut by a characteristic in more than one point, are considered. An application of the extensions to onedimensional gas dynamics is made.

The Effects of Daridorexant on Patients With Comorbid Insomnia Disorder and Untreated Mild Obstructive Sleep Apnoea: A Post Hoc Subgroup Analysis of a Phase 3, Randomised Clinical Trial

open access: yesJournal of Sleep Research, Volume 35, Issue 2, April 2026.
ABSTRACT Daridorexant, a dual orexin receptor antagonist, is approved for the treatment of insomnia disorder in adults. Approximately 30%–35% of patients with insomnia disorder also have obstructive sleep apnoea (OSA) of any severity. It is unclear whether sleep medications provide safe and effective treatment for insomnia in these patients.
